1. A 68-year-old woman is admitted after a fall at home.
As the practical nurse begins the initial assessment,
which action best reflects the nurse’s primary
responsibility under the nursing process?
A. Teach the patient about fall precautions.
B. Perform a focused physical assessment to identify
injuries and immediate risks.

, C. Notify the family about the incident.
D. Complete incident reporting documentation.
Correct answer: B
Rationale: The first nursing responsibility is assessment to
identify immediate problems and safety risks; teaching and
documentation follow.

2. Which statement best describes the concept of clinical
judgment for the practical nurse in medical-surgical
care?
A. Relying solely on standardized protocols for all
patients.
B. Using critical thinking to interpret assessment data
and prioritize interventions.
C. Deferring all decision-making to the RN or
physician.
D. Memorizing diagnostic criteria for common
conditions.
Correct answer: B
Rationale: Clinical judgment integrates assessment,
interpretation, and prioritization to choose appropriate
interventions within scope.

3. Select all that apply. Which elements are essential
components of a thorough nursing assessment on
admission to a medical-surgical unit?
A. Current medications and allergies
B. Functional status and mobility level
C. Financial history and insurance details
D. Baseline vital signs and pain assessment
E. Detailed psychiatric history unrelated to current
problem
Correct answers: A, B, D
Rationale: Medication/allergies, function/mobility, and
baseline vitals/pain are high-yield for immediate care;
financial details and nonrelevant psychiatric history are not
essential for immediate nursing assessment.

4. A patient with impaired mobility is placed on bedrest.
Which nursing intervention has the highest priority to
prevent complications of immobility?
A. Provide frequent oral hygiene.
B. Encourage incentive spirometry every 2 hours while
awake.

, C. Offer skin moisturizer each shift.
D. Teach range of motion exercises for the unaffected
limb only.
Correct answer: B
Rationale: Preventing respiratory complications
(atelectasis, pneumonia) via incentive spirometry is a high-
priority nursing action for immobile patients.

5. Which action demonstrates appropriate delegation by
the practical nurse working with unregulated care
providers (UCPs)?
A. Delegating the initial assessment of a newly
admitted patient.
B. Asking the UCP to measure and record routine vital
signs for a stable patient.
C. Delegating medication administration to the UCP.
D. Assigning a UCP to develop the patient’s
individualized care plan.
Correct answer: B
Rationale: Delegation should match the UCP’s scope and
competence; routine stable vital signs are appropriate
tasks. Assessment, medication administration, and care
planning are not delegable.
